Middle East losses and subcontinent wins: the paradox of IGI’s second quarter

“The Middle East war-related losses in aggregate are likely to be like or looking like they’ll be the largest single event loss in IGI’s almost 25-year history,” president and CEO of IGI, Waleed Jabsheh  told analysts on the second quarter earnings call, Wednesday (August 5).
